There is no Form 1099E - do you mean Form 1098-E for student loan interest?
If so, then, yes, you should include this information on your tax return as it could potentially be a tax deduction for you.
Student loan interest paid (Form 1098E) can be found in the Education section of Deductions and Credits. You can enter this by using the search (upper right corner of your TurboTax screen) - search for "1098E" (make sure enter the E because there is another form for mortgage interest that is 1098) and click the "jump to 1098E" link. This will bring you to the right section.
